Chapter 2261 Maintenance



"Are you ever going to stop? Instead of gossiping, you should be doing your own thing..." Hongli wasn't angry, but Hongzhou next to him had red eyes and was clenching his fists as he roared.

Everyone turned to look at Hongzhou. They thought Hongzhou was deliberately avoiding Hongli, and that the two had a falling out. They hadn't been mindful of Hongzhou when they spoke. But when they heard others gossiping about Hongli, they still couldn't hold back their anger towards Hongli, which caused everyone to vent their anger on Hongzhou.

Hongtai stood in front of Hongzhou and said with a grin, "Oh... you can't say that anymore? It was just a joke between brothers, and Hongli didn't even take it seriously, yet you're standing up for him?"

Hongzhou glared at the other person defiantly and said, "You can't win over the Emperor yourself, so you're trying to sow discord here. Be careful, or the Emperor will dislike you even more if he finds out..."

Hongtai was the eldest son of Prince Cheng, and his personality was very similar to that of the Third Prince's wife. After hearing this, he pointed at Hongzhou and said angrily, "What...what did you say?"

Hongzhou took a step forward without ceremony, but Hongli quickly stopped him, saying, "It's alright, a few words won't matter, let's not delay the important matter..."

Hongzhou pushed Hongli aside and said, "You're all jealous of Hongli. It's none of your business how much the Emperor values ​​and likes Hongli. Besides, if something had happened to that old man just now, would the Five Perfections Elders have been properly counted? If the Emperor blamed you, could any of you bear the responsibility? Hongli did the right thing, protecting all of you. Instead of being grateful, you're here making sarcastic remarks..."

After Hongzhou finished listing his grievances in one breath, everyone was speechless. One person quietly dispersed, and everyone silently returned to their respective positions.

Hongli looked at Hongzhou gratefully and smiled. Hongzhou was still angry and turned his head away with a red face, but Hongli knew that Hongzhou was still on his side, and his heart warmed.

The banquet for the elderly officially began. The Jiuzhou Qingyan in the Yuanmingyuan Garden was decorated solemnly and grandly, showcasing the imperial grandeur in every aspect.

The garden was draped in colorful silk, a dazzling spectacle of color, with palace lanterns hanging from the rooftops. A thousand long tables and benches were arranged in a row in the courtyard of Jiuzhou Qingyan, creating a magnificent scene. Thousands of palace maids and eunuchs moved about in front of the tables and chairs, where fresh flowers and pastries were laid out. A thousand elderly people took their seats, supporting each other and praising the scenery of the courtyard. Some even lingered over the tables and chairs, reluctant to sit down.

Once everyone was seated, a shout rang out: "His Majesty has arrived!"

Kangxi slowly walked in, surrounded by a crowd. He was dressed in a yellow robe with dragons playing with pearls on it. He had an extraordinary bearing. Although he was no longer as brave and powerful as he used to be, he still had the aura of a monarch and the power to shake the mountains and rivers.

Behind him was Li Dequan's entourage, followed by his grandsons and other princes.

In an instant, the entire arena fell silent. Everyone rose and knelt, hearing the arrival of the imperial envoy. Three whips were cracked, and the music and drums ceased. Everyone bowed and shouted, "Long live the Emperor! Long live the Emperor! Long live the Emperor!"

After Kangxi was seated on the dragon throne at the very front of the platform, he nodded and smiled, saying, "Please rise, everyone. Today, I have specially organized this banquet for the Thousand Elders. All those present are accomplished elders and deserve our utmost respect. There is no need for excessive formalities..."

The elderly people thanked them profusely several times before sitting down one by one.

Looking at the five-fold elders seated below, Emperor Kangxi was filled with emotion. He was also very satisfied with the arrangements for the banquet for the thousand elders. Smiling, he surveyed the entire room and then gestured to Li Dequan. Li Dequan bowed, stepped back a few paces, and glanced at the princes. The princes then obediently went to direct the palace maids and eunuchs to prepare the meal in an orderly manner, and the banquet began smoothly...
